Program areas at Resilient Agency
CHWOI - Since the onset of the pandemic Resilient has been partnered with the Los Angeles County Department of Health to provide much needed COVID 19 Relief services. This program Resilient facilitates allows a staff of 8 to distribute PPE material such as face mask hand sanitizer gloves antigen test kits hygiene kits and flyers of resources pertaining to Covid 19 relief and conduct CPR trainings. In addition to services mentioned Resilient staff facilitates weekly pop up events and participates in resource education and CPR trainingss. We have provided these services in the areas of South LA and Echo Park From January 1 st 2023 through December 31 st 202 33,204 participants have been impacted through CHWOI program.5
Community Support - Resilient provides weekly food distributions in the areas of South LA and Echo Park areas of Los Angeles. We distribute meat poultry diary vegetables bread and fruit to 200 families weekly. Since the start of our food distribution programs in 2020 we have served over 50,982 families by providing them much needed groceries. For Resilients seasonal events such as Back to School giveaways turkey giveaways and holiday toy giveaways Resilient distributes to 1,500 children in the communities of South La and Echo Park simultaneously annually. This results in an annual distribution of 13,500 items that include back packs school supplies turkeys and toys.
CIW - Resilient provides public safety in the form of gang intervention and prevention In the community located east of the 110 freeway of South Los Angeles in Los Angeles Council District 9. Our staff of three on this program are responsible for mediating conflict within the communities of Council District 9 including South Park and Trinity Park. This work involves staff developing local and regional truces between rival gangs to de escalate retaliatory efforts between gangs and broker agreements of understanding between gangs to reduce and completely stop shootings. Also staff is responsible for connecting gang involved youth at risk youth and their families to supportive services and help them obtain work ready documents. The duration of the program from September 1 2023 through December 31 2023 which in that time our staff has mediated between rival gangs and stopped shootings in the South Park area as well as facilitated peace maintenance activities. We have contributed to the decline of violent crimes in the South Park and Trinity Park area.
